Report No. 5 of the Board of Accounts, 12 January 1786

Author:Bruce, Andrew
Date:1786-01-12
Subjects:Anderson, William paid by military: freighting goods to St. Anne's p. 3
Board of Accounts [II] sits 1786/1/12
Booth, John paid by the military at Fort Howe p. 2
Chapman, Thomas contractor for work at Fort Cumberland p. 2
Chapman, William contractor for work at Fort Cumberland p. 2
Colvill, Captain [ ] at Fort Howe 1786/1/12
Dixon, Charles contractor for work at Fort Cumberland p. 2
Fitch, [ ] Apparently at St. John: an ironmonger, perhaps associated with N. Rogers p. 3
Fort Cumberland work carried out at p. 2
Hallet, Samuel [Senior] Freights provisions for the military to St. Anne's p. 3
Ironmongers Fitch and Nehemiah Rogers, apparently at St. John p. 3
Lewis and Ryan apparently of St. John: printers: paid by the military at Fort Howe p. 3
Phipps, Jediah [sic] At Fort Howe: his pay p. 1
Robertson, William at Fort Howe: paid by the military p. 2
Rogers, Nehemiah of St. John: an ironmonger: perhaps associated with [ ] Fitch p. 3
Sands, Edward paid for barrels of flour p. 2
Smith, William of St. John: rents his house to the Governor's guard: paid by the military p. 3
Tyler, John Freights provisions for the military to St. Anne's p. 3
Wetmore, Thomas commissariat clerk at St. John p. 2
Source:Vol. 5-12
